Compost Indoors
Indoor composting has become essential for managing waste in today's
modern society. With large segments of urban populations living in
apartments, condos and other large residential complexes, the fact is many
people do not have access to their own backyard. Although composting has
been around millennia, only recently has indoor composting become feasible.
Through advancements in design, social enterprises like Composting Condos
have taken the fundamentals of traditional backyard composting and combined
them with basic science and technology to improve the process, making indoor
composting more effective, efficient and compact.
Indoor composting reduces footprint
Indoor composting is the latest wave of home-based sustainable systems
hitting the market to cater to ever-conscious consumers. Through the daily
practice of indoor composting, global citizens can reduce their waste
footprint by up to 50% while giving back to the earth by enriching soils,
preserving biodiversity and cultivating new life in the form of plants and
food. Indoor composting is hugely rewarding and helping to reconnect people
with the land, a basic understanding that has be lost in the rapid growth
and urbanization of our societies.
Indoor composters improve process
Indoor composting can be achieved somewhat effectively with a basic
container and months of time to allow the decomposition process to take
place, however this bare-bones system leads to strong odors, excessive
liquids and other composting obstacles. On the other hand, by using an
innovative indoor composter to manage your daily composting needs, you will
find that indoor composting can be achieved in a matter of weeks, without
